One day life is good. The next day it isn't! The boundaries between... well, whatever they're between.. have shattered! Monsters burst out from cracks in the universe, and reality suddenly begins to function similar to a game -- but not a game that anyone knows all the rules about! Magic is suddenly real, but so are monsters and death! Lots of death!And the worst part of it all?I think we did it to ourselves! We invented video games, and personally I think that great Finger-in-the-Sky picked up a console somewhere and started playing them. Since He liked what he saw, he must've declared, """"On the 8th Day, let there be Game!"But what do I know about it all, really. After all, I'm just """"The Witness"""" forced to observe it all.__________________________________________________________________________Author's Note: There's a lot of tales where characters get stuck in a Virtual Reality. """"Sword Art Online"""", """"Log Horizon"""", """"The Legendary Moonlight Sculptor"""". This is a story told with the premise inverted -- instead of a person from reality going into a virtual world, what would happen if the virtual world instead came to reality?I want this tale to speak about the aspects of the game, as it has affected the current reality, but the focus of the story should never be on the """"reality-turned-game"""" itself, but on the characters and their oh-so-human struggles, personalities, and attempt to adjust and live within the bounds of their new existence.Hopefully this won't just be a story of """"reality turned into a game"""", but instead will be something more meaningful such as a story of the strengths, perseverance, and humanity of man-kind as they try to adapt and face the unknown.*** And, most importantly, I hope everyone enjoys reading it as much as I've enjoyed writing it. ***WARNING: RATED MATURE M[18+] FOR GORE, SEX, VIOLENCE. The apocalypse isn't a pretty place to try to survive in, and neither is every scene in a story trying to describe it.

    I've been lurking on the site for ages, reading here and there and finding some stories which I liked and a whole bunch that I didn't.  And then I found this story, and I loved it enough, that I wanted to support it so that my views would help offset some of the people who don't "get it".
    This isn't a tale of a super powerful  guy who gets popped into a fantasy world and then proceeds to destroy everything and take over.  It's a tale of a plain, or even a little below average, high school boy who gets stuck witnessing the end of the world.  He has no great fighting skills, no great military or crafting skills.  He doesn't just pick up a piece of metal, pound it twice with his fist and presto!  Magic Sword of Kickass +3000!
    He's not a builder.  Not a crafter.  Not a warrior, and doesn't have any magic or super power which he can utilize to quickly out power everyone else.  What does he have?   Simply the ability to come back to life and keep trying after he dies.  He won't stay dead, but that doesn't mean he can just blaze his way past everything.   At one point, he gets cocky and thinks he's a bad dude -- and he prompt gets eaten by rats.  And, when he comes back to life close to them, he gets eaten again.  And again.  And again.  And once more for good measure, I think!
    Just because you can come back and try over, it doesn't mean you'll eventually succeed.  No matter how many times you come back to life and jump into a bubbling volcano, you're not going to eventually jump across it.   It's that sort of sensation.  And I like it!
    People say the character is an idiot they can't relate to.  Why?  I manage to relate to him just fine.  He has struggles of morality, and I like that a lot.  "I only did what I had to do" is what he tells himself, and yet after a bit, he realizes that he simply doesn't want to use that excuse to allow himself to give up on his humanity.

    This is truly a story I've been looking for. For a while now I've been reading apocalyptic fics and always the main character is confident in knowing what to do, has the intelligence to figure everything out, and just gathers followers that never question anything he does as the smartest choice because that's obviously the best choice the author can think up.
    But sitting here reading your work, I see the situations your characters get into and I can on the spot think of better ways to do the things they're doing and I'll assume you likely can too. But you choose instead to embrace who your character is and their level of knowledge and confidence. You have them handle a situation not how you would, but how someone in their situation, with their experience, their knowledge, their personality would. That's what's truly moving about this fic, not that the characters are the most badass around, but that they lack confidence, doubt themselves, but then do the most courageous thing, they accept that fact and work through it together. Being strong alone is a lot easier than admitting to someone that you can't do it alone and asking for their help.
